Ananya Panday, a young movie actress from India, has been picked by Chanel, a famous brand from France, as their first brand face in India. This big news came on April 16. Chanel said they are happy to choose Ananya because she shows the new generation — young people who are brave, full of new ideas, and proud of who they are.
Chanel also said that Ananya’s way of thinking is close to what the brand believes. They feel she is the right person to show what the brand stands for. Ananya said she feels the brand gives freedom to people to be themselves in a stylish and graceful way.
Many people guessed this would happen. Last year, Ananya went to a fashion show in Paris and wore clothes made by Chanel. She went with her sister, Rysa Panday. Since that day, people thought she might become the face of Chanel, and now it has happened.
Ananya has worked with other big brands too. She is also the face of Swarovski. She worked with Jimmy Choo in their India ads. She also speaks for brands like Lakmé, Beats, and Timex.
Other Indian stars also work with big brands around the world. Sonam Kapoor is linked with Dior. Alia Bhatt works with Gucci. Deepika Padukone works with Louis Vuitton. Aishwarya Rai has worked with L'Oréal for many years.
